Visual basic 6 database howto gives an indepth view of each major method of data access, with reallife examples with which to work. Net allows you many ways to connect to a database or a data source. Database is connected only if any changes made to the copy of the. So is this possible this methoddim con as new oledbconnectionprovidermicrosoft. How to connect microsoft access database with visual basic 6. On the file menu, point to new, and then click project.
Net framework provides two types of connection classes. A gridview control will display the list of files present in the sql server database table along with an option to download the selected file from database in. In our batch it just so happens the lecturers decided that for. Access database viewer and tools, including excel exporter. We also have other visual basic product galleries for. On the left side of the database, microsoft access objects are listed by categories.
If you are not familiar with how to add reference and create pdf file, just follow the link. Login form with adodc connection to msaccess in vb6. Two microsoft access mvps show how you can become an access power user microsoft access is the worlds leading database system, with millions of users and hundreds of thousands of developers. Active x control to navigate and edit a database version 1. Databases are used in various situations such as keeping a record. Download the microsoft access database you need for these tutorials. Using excel macros vba you can connect to any databases like sql, oracle or access db. We are providing dot net programming examples projects with source code, database, and documentation. Introduction so the target audience is my fellow degree friends at mmu taking a notorious subject called software engineering fundamentals. In the absence of this parameter, the recordset will be opened with the value of the source property of the recordset object.
How to connect microsoft access 2007 to visual basic 2010 tutorial by ma. How to connect to access database ado connection string. In the databases are connected first, then a copy of the database is stored in the memory immediatley the connection to the database is disconnected. Visual basic programming connectivity with crystal report by narinder kumar sharma 944 international journal of research. It documents the mysql for visual studio through 1. Visual basic 2010 lesson 30 creating connection to database. Before creating pdf file we should read the data from database using sql query string. Net changes 49 4 building classes and assemblies with vb.
Create a blank form and add a datagridview on to it. I have same question i have application and oledb database. Through it all, the objective is to give you the information you need in a concise manner, using examples and stepbystep procedures rather than brief, acronymladen blurbs. Net solution in your account and add a new project to the solution. Follow these steps to create a new console application in visual basic. Updating your database by using datasets managing concurrency its time now to get into some real database programming with the. The adodb object can create a connection to microsoft access 2003 databases. Netcomplete image viewer application display data of ms. Knowledge of programming elements, such as functions and loops, and knowledge of databases and sql is required to write effective code in microsoft visual basic to connect to microsoft access 2003 databases. It includes basic code snippets on how to add, update, and delete records on your database using winforms and vb.
Overview foreword viii introduction 1 1 why should you move to visual basic. Abstract in this post im running through trying to get your vb. In this article you will learn, how you can do a connection with an access database. It retrieves data from a database into a dataset and updates the database. Visual basic database projects contains three programs you can use at home. You can name your project as database project 1 or whatever name you wish to call it. Here mudassar ahmed khan has explained with an example, how to upload files to sql server database in asp. Ado excel vba sql connecting to database example macros. When changes are made to the dataset, the changes in the database are actually done by the data adapter.
Next, change the default forms text property to contacts as we will be building a database of a contact list. Some restrictions are also there in this application to perform these operations for better results and access. Configuring and using open database connectivity odbc creating an odbc data source testing a database connection with odbcping accessing a clientserver data source with the visual basic data control and odbcdirect. Millions of eager users make access the most popular database system in the world these microsoft mvps exploit key.
Anybody who has microsoft office with msword, also has access and the programming language visual basic behind access. Upload and download files from sql server database in asp. Notice that this connection string provides the full file path to the database file itself, specified through the data source parameter. A database in this context refers to any collection of related data used by your application. After download the zip file, extract it and add the reference to your project. Net framework data provider for sql server provides access to microsoft sql server. When you click on connect button, from the output, you can see that the database connection was established. Introduction to database programming chapter 10 when a program needs to manage a large amount of data, a database is a good way to store and retrieve the data. I want to share the database between 3 pc and any pc can update the database by lan connection. The best practices, tips, and techniques in this book can turn users into power users. Some typical examples of information that may be stored in a database include.
Vb 2010 express connected to database microsoft access. Please consult sql server tutorial for creating databases and database tables in sql server. Msgboxconnectstr create connection to the db using connection as new system. Net programming for beginners a really simple database vb. Example 1 we have a table stored in microsoft sql server, named customers, in a database named testdb. Creating an access database project with visual studio. So click on data sources on the left of the toolbox if you cant see the tab, click view other windows data sources.
Once you have saved the database to your own computer, you can begin. We have a table stored in microsoft sql server, named customers, in a database named testdb. Visual basic 2008, visual basic 2005, visual basic. Oledb now in your code, create some variable to store the information you will be using later. We can use ado in excel vba to connect the data base and perform data manipulating operations. Visual basic connectivity with access databse learn. There are following different types of data providers included in ado. This should automatically create a blank form for you.
Free visual basic 6 tutorials database connectivity. Download the latest version of visual basic database. Net program to read and write to an access database. Net is one of the best popular languages for students to develop their final year mini and major educational projects. Whenever we design an application in vb, we always use to secure our application by adding login form with username and password. Like all books in the successful howto series, visual basic 6 database howto emphasizes a stepbystep problemsolving approach to visual basic programming. Since we are using sql server 2008 as the database engine, we will use microsoft studio management express to create a database with the mdf extension. So, in the above code, notice the getconnectionstring function just returns a connection string to an access 2010 database.
We need add microsoft activex data objects library from references to reference the ado in vba. Connect to access db how to connect to an access database. Thanks for contributing an answer to stack overflow. Visual basic programming connectivity with crystal report. The technology used to interact with a database or data source is called ado. This is the mysql for visual studio reference manual.
In the new project dialog box, click visual basic projects under project types, and then click console application under templates. Public function testmainbyval args as object as object connection string to ms access db dim connectstr as string providermicrosoft. For notes detailing the changes in each release, see the mysql for visual studio release notes. Net contains such useful classes to work with the databases as. Net, along with the xml namespace, is a core part of microsofts standard for data access and storage. In visual basic 2010, we need to create the connection to a database before we can access its data.
Ms access is also a good illustration of many principles that exist on other platforms too, for instance a relational database, a graphical user interface gui. Question answer database program in visual basic 6. How to connect to a database and run a command by using. The files will be uploaded using fileupload control and will be inserted into sql server database table. Many of the products listed here have free visual basic 2010 trials available as a vb 2010 download from our visual basic 2010 marketplace. It is used to interact with a database or a data source. Create a new project and give it the name addressbook. The source may be a command object variable, a sql statement, a table, or a stored procedure. Download the file by clicking the download button and saving the file to your hard disk doubleclick the accessdatabaseengine. Access database connection string is different for access 2003. Below is the simple application which allows to insert, update, delete, search and navigation in database using as frontend. To begin building the database project in visual basic 2017, launch visual basic 2017. Vb 2010 express connected to database microsoft access 2010.
1168 879 834 1114 267 1297 222 7 1447 315 83 953 234 923 1525 957 488 1160 1527 659 80 958 1146 120 581 785 596 1242 751 1230 817 1023 1148 522 492 520 1257 776 10 664 185 201